What is an allusion?
Back
An allusion is a reference to a well-known person, place, event, or work of art. It is often used to make a comparison or to add meaning.

What is a metaphor?
Back
A metaphor is a figure of speech that makes a direct comparison between two unlike things by stating that one is the other.

What is hyperbole?
Back
Hyperbole is an exaggerated statement that is not meant to be taken literally, used for emphasis or effect.

What is onomatopoeia?
Back
Onomatopoeia is a word that imitates the natural sound of a thing, such as 'thump' or 'buzz'.

What is a simile?
Back
A simile is a figure of speech that compares two different things using the words 'like' or 'as'.

What is personification?
Back
Personification is a figure of speech in which human qualities are attributed to animals, inanimate objects, or abstract concepts.

What is an idiom?
Back
An idiom is a phrase or expression that has a figurative meaning different from its literal meaning.
